Job description

Hackney CVS is looking for a Development Manager to lead our Organisational Development work and strengthen support for the voluntary and community sector (VCS) across Hackney and the City of London.

This is a key role, overseeing a small team and shaping a high-quality, responsive offer of training, advice and capacity building for local organisations. You will work closely with VCS groups of all sizes, building trusted relationships and ensuring our support reflects the realities they face.

You will also connect insight from the sector with funders, partners and stakeholders, helping to improve access to resources and opportunities. Working across Hackney CVS, you will collaborate with colleagues to ensure our work is joined up, impactful and aligned with organisational priorities.

We are looking for someone with strong experience in organisational development within the VCS, with the ability to lead, build relationships and think strategically. A commitment to equity, diversity and inclusion is essential, particularly in supporting organisations led by and working with underrepresented communities.

If you’re interested in this exciting opportunity to shape how infrastructure support is delivered locally, we’d love to hear from you.

The role is offered for 3 days a week, on a 12 month fixed term basis, with the potential for extension subject to funding.
